Because Low Earth Orbit (LEO) satellite has very limited contact time between satellite and ground station, all telemetry data generated on satellite are stored in a mass memory and downlinked to the ground together with real-time data during the contact time. There are two mass memory modules. Normally, one mass memory module is used and the other is ready for backup. If required, both memory modules can be used at the same time. If the selected module is not available, the other module can be automatically used for telemetry storage without ground intervention. Two downlink channels are available at the same time but only one channel should be used for downlink. The downlink channel can be changed automatically by on-board flight software as well as step by step by ground command. This paper presents the telemetry storage and downlink management method implemented in flight software of a LEO satellite developed in Korea. All functions related to telemetry storage and downlink management were fully verified through the real satellite operation as well as the various tests during satellite development phase.
